Web27 Jul 2024 · Complete and sign a statement on the Certification by U.S. Person Residing in the U.S. (Form 14654) PDF certifying: (1) that you are eligible for the Streamlined Domestic Offshore Procedures; (2) that all required FBARs have now been filed (see instruction 9 below); (3) that the failure to report all income, pay all tax, and submit all required ...
